Lourdes Monterrubio Ibáñez is a Ramón y Cajal Senior Research Fellow at the Department of Communication at Pompeu Fabra University. She previously was awarded a Marie-Sklodowska Curie Actions – Individual Fellowship with the project EDEF – Enunciative Devices of the European Francophone Essay Film that she developed at the Institut ACTE, Université Paris 1 Panthéon-Sorbonne. She holds a PhD in Comparative Studies and a degree in French Studies from the Complutense University of Madrid and completed the Diploma in Film Direction at the ECAM (Escuela de Cinematografía y del Audiovisual de la Comunidad de Madrid). She was also film critic for Cahiers du cinéma – España and Caimán Cuadernos de Cine.

Her research focuses on cinematic modernity and contemporary audiovisual creation, filmic writings of the self, literature-cinema relationships, female authorship and francophone production. She has published widely on epistolary cinema (Shangrila Ediciones 2018, Área Abierta 2019, Visual Studies 2020, Feminist Media Studies 2021, among others) and the essay film (Gedisa, 2019, Studies in Spanish & Latin American Cinemas 2019, Quarterly Review of Film and Video 2021, 2023, Studies in European Cinema 2022, Comparative Cinema 2022, Arte, Individuo y Sociedad, 2023, among others). She has also worked on audiovisual autofiction (Peter Lang 2018, New Review of Film and Television Studies 2021), contemporary cinema (Comunicación 2017, L'Atalante 2018), the film diary and the cinematic self-portrait (Arte, individuo y sociedad 2019, Comparative Cinema 2016).
